Wildlife gardening Lesson 2 – Plants and pollinators

Join Jo Worthy-Jones in her fortnightly live Masterclass and learn how you can attract wildlife into your garden.

In this lesson you’ll learn about the relationship between plants and pollinators in our gardens and why a variety of plant shapes, sizes and flowering times is important.

The session will start with Wildlife Gardening Tips and Q&A and feature a life cycle or information about wildlife likely to be seen in gardens.  The sessions will be interactive and future sessions can be adapted to suit the group if there are particular areas of interest. 

Participants will be encouraged to share their own sightings and shown how to record them to help build up a picture of wildlife in their locality.
